    Why Ciscomotors Engine don't start?

      If your Ciscomotors Engine doesn't start, several factors could be at play. First, ensure that there is fuel in the tank; if not, fill it. A clogged fuel line or fuel filter could also be the culprit, in which case you should replace and clean them. Check the diaphragm fuel pump for damage and replace it if broken. Make sure the engine stop switch is in the OFF position. A faulty spark plug could also prevent the engine from starting, so replace it. Finally, a broken or shorted ignition coil can cause this issue, and it should be replaced.

    What to do if Ciscomotors BullMax 250 Engine lacks power?

      If your Ciscomotors Engine lacks power, it might be due to a fuel-air mixture that is too lean; in this case, unscrew the L screw. Alternatively, the fuel-air mixture could be too rich, requiring you to tighten the L screw. A clogged fuel line or fuel filter can also cause a power reduction, so replace or clean them. Finally, check the air filter for clogs and replace or clean it as needed.
